Season 27 Episode 2: Microscopic entomology and 3D mammography
Mammography is a powerful tool for detecting breast cancer. An Italian study has revealed how it can be made even more effective. In this feature, Paolo Magliocco and Rossella Li Vigni explain what 3D mammography is. Stromboli and its frequent eruptions attract tourists from around the world. For Superquark, Barbara Bernardini went to see how volcanologists work to predict eruptions and ensure the safety of residents and visitors. A curious feature from our correspondents shows us strange prehistoric creatures, or alien monsters, that are actually just common insects, such as flies or mosquitoes, seen under an electron microscope. A tool used by "microscopic entomology" to reveal the secrets of these complex, and unloved, living beings.
